Dutch vs South American Master's Degree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 553,710,662 people shows no correlation between the proportion of Dutch and percentage of population with at least master's degree education in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.005 and weighted average of 13.8%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 493,882,123 people shows a poor positive correlation between the proportion of South Americans and percentage of population with at least master's degree education in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.125 and weighted average of 15.6%, a difference of 13.2%.
